Frequently asked questions

Why does compression vary between PDFs?

Every PDF contains a different mix of images, fonts and document structures, so the achievable reduction is different for each file.

What does Already optimized mean?

It means ToolSphere could not create a smaller safe result, so keeping the original bytes avoids increasing the file size or reducing quality unnecessarily.

Which compression level should I choose?

Basic is a sensible starting point, Moderate balances quality and size, and Strong targets the smallest practical result.
